- I recently purchased the document "SAS/ASSIST Software:
- Your Interface to the SAS System" (Version 6.06, 1st Ed., 1990, $9.95).
- I find it almost wholly worthless. Others may have different views.
- What it illustrates is the domination of a marketing ethos over an
- educational one. The publication seems, like so many commercial
- software manuals, more intended to sell a product to a busy executive.
- He will never use it, but his secretarial assistant might. It is
- largely uninformative describing the wonders that the user can
- accomplish but not actually telling him how to do it.
- It is done slickly on expensive papers with lots of
- multicolored screen graphics (red, white, blue and yellow) on black
- in a font so small that only eagles and adolescents can possibly
- read them (for what they are worth - which is little) without
- magnifying glasses.
- I would strongly reccommend that no one purchase this
- unfortunate document and invest the money in some of their much
- more worthwhile manuals.
